TB is one of the deadliest infecticide diseases globally, with 10.8 million new cases and 1.25 million deaths in 2023. Effective screening for tb is an important intervention to quick Its spread and ultimately eliminate the disease.

TB Can Remain Dormant in the Body for Some Years Without Causing The Symptoms of the Disease But May Cause Active Disease in the future, Especially among certain people at HIGH Risk. Accurate Testing of Bost Active and Dormant Infection is therefore of critical importance in screening programs.

Testing for tb can take a range of forms, include chest x-rays, sputum cultures, molecular testing, screening for symptoms, and skin or blood tests to measure dormant tb infection (tbi). All types of tests aim to accurately detect tb with low numbers of False Positive Results to Avoid Unnecessary Treatment.

A Team LED by Dr. Dominik zenner, Clinical Reader in Infety Disease Epidemiology at Queen Mary, Analyzed The Efficiency of Combinations of Commonly Used Tests for TB.

Their study, Published in the European Respiratory JournalExamined data on 13 different tb tests as described in 437 original studies and published systematic reviews. These data were then used to estimate how good screening tests are at both correctly identifying tb and avoiding false positive results.

Unlike Previous Studies, The Researchers Found That Including Some Immunological Tests for Dormant TB Infection (TBI Tests) Added Value to TB SCRENING Algorithms. TBI Tests Blad also Support Earlier Diagnosis of Harder to Detect TB, Including Extrapulmonary TB (Disease That Occurs Occurs Outside the Patient’s Lungs) or TB In Children.

This Novel Approach Challenges existing protocols for tb testing, which reserve tbi tests for diagnosing dormant tb only. Importantly, Combining Diagnostic Tests for Both Dormant and Active TB BOLLD Allow for Both Forms of the Disease to Be Detected Concurrently.

This Opportunity to Improve Detection of TB Across Large Population is of Interest to Policy-Makers and Public Health Organizations, Including Who and the European Center for Disease Prevention and Constrol.

Dr. Zenner said, “Global tb control requires early identification and treatment of tb in rain group. High Accuracy for Migrants from Countries where tb is common to improve individual and population benefits. “

Mario raviglione, Former Director of the Global Tuberculosis (TB) Program at the World Health Organization and Currently Professor of Global Health at the University of Milan, Milan, SAID Sophisticated and well-thought study with Major Implications for Clinical and Public Health Practice, as well as policy change.

“By reviewing sound evidence and applying modern statistical methods, the authors have concluded that adopting an interferon gamma release assay (igra) test – a blood test that detects the response of white Blood tests to tb antigens – on top of more traditional tb screening methods, the accuracy of screening migrants for active tb increases significly. “
